  • Prerequisites: Basic knowledge of the problems of digital humanities, theories and methodologies of literary criticism, and skills in the use of computers
  • Objectives: The course aims at providing a theoretical and practical knowledge in the application of digital methods and tools for the representation encoding and analysis of cltural phenomena and texts (literary and not). In line with the educational objectives of the Study Program stated in the SUA-CdS (sections A.4.b.2, A.4.c), the course aims to provide students with the following knowledge and skills: - Knowledge and understanding: At the end of the course, students are expected to show sufficient skills in the techniques and issues related to the creation and the dissemination of electronic documents and the creation and management of digital text archives. - Applying knowledge and understanding: Students will be required to develop autonomy and flexibility in creating links between the contents of this course and those of the lierary and linguistic courses of the degree. - Making judgements: Since the course concentrates on innovative methods and topics, students are expected to exercise their independent judgment on them within the limits imposed by their own skills. - Communication skills: Students will be able to critically examine and explain the contents learned during the course ad to apply the methods and tools presented in classes. - Learning skills: Students will be able to work autonomously and in groups, and to search for information from a variety of up-to-date, academically relevant electronic sources, including standard reference works on the course contents.
